What is 45/27 Divided By 2/6

Answer: 4527÷26\frac{45}{27}\div\frac{2}{6} = 51\frac{5}{1}

Solving 4527÷26\frac{45}{27}\div\frac{2}{6}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

4527÷26=4527×62\frac{45}{27} \div \frac{2}{6} = \frac{45}{27} \times \frac{6}{2}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 45×6=27045 \times 6 = 270
  • Multiply the Denominators: 27×2=5427 \times 2 = 54
  • Form the New Fraction: 4527×26=27054\frac{45}{27} \times \frac{2}{6} = \frac{270}{54}

Let's Simplify 27054\frac{270}{54}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 270270 and 5454. The GCD of 270270 and 5454 is 5454.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:270÷5454÷54=51\frac{270 \div 54}{54 \div 54} = \frac{5}{1}

Answer 4527÷26=51\frac{45}{27}\div\frac{2}{6} = \frac{5}{1}
